Outpost on Syrinx, released in 2020, is an atmospheric indie adventure game that invites players to establish a base for humanity on a wondrous alien world. With a focus on exploration and uncovering alien mysteries, the game offers a unique blend of storytelling and engaging gameplay. Its distinctive setting and themes set it apart in the indie genre, drawing players into its visually captivating environment.
